Macron and Trump take differing positions on Iran deal

During a speech to the US joint houses of Congress, French President Macron advocated for staying with the Iran nuclear deal and denounced isolationist policies. RT America’s Anya Parampil reports.

Leading Western news outlets supported Syria strikes

Nearly all of the leading Western media outlets have featured guests supporting US intervention in Syria, following recent airstrikes. Many unlikely news sources were also in favor of military intervention. RT America’s Dan Cohen reports.

Debate: Is Macron challenging Trump’s agenda?

RT America’s Ed Schultz is joined by Florida Democratic Party chair Mitch Ceasar and Carrie Sheffield, national editor for Accuracy in Media, to discuss French President Emmanuel Macron’s address to Congress on Wednesday.
